Miscarriage Counseling: Processing Grief and Loss
After a miscarriage, emotions can feel overwhelming. It's normal to experience waves of of grief, sadness, anger, or even guilt. You may wonder how to process these complex emotions and begin to heal. Miscarriage counseling can provide a safe and supportive space to explore your feelings and develop coping mechanisms.
A skilled counselor can help you navigate the emotional impact of miscarriage. They will listen without judgment and offer guidance as you work through your grief. Counseling can also help you connect with others who have experienced similar losses, which can be incredibly helpful in feeling less alone.
Remember that there is no right or wrong way to grieve. Allow yourself time to heal at your own pace. It's important to be kind to yourself and seek support when you need it.
Miscarriage counseling can provide the tools and resources to help you cope with loss and move forward in a healthy way.

Embracing Hope and Strength After Pregnancy Loss
Pregnancy loss can be an incredibly devastating experience. The grief that follows is often profound and unique, leaving you feeling lost and alone. But it's important to remember that you are not alone in this journey, and healing is possible.
While there is no quick fix for the pain of pregnancy loss, taking steps to nurture your emotional and physical well-being can aid your healing process.
Allow yourself time to grieve and express your emotions in a way that feels right. Sharing with loved ones, joining a support group, or seeking professional help from a therapist can provide invaluable understanding.
Remember that self-care is crucial during this time. Practice mindful activities like yoga, meditation, or spending time in nature to soothe your mind and body. Be patient with yourself as you navigate this challenging chapter of your life. Healing takes time, but with each passing day, you will find strength growing.
